python中获得字典的长度
时间: 2024-10-25 22:10:23 浏览: 16
python 中字典嵌套列表的方法
5星 · 资源好评率100%
在Python中,要获取字典的长度,你可以使用内置的`len()`函数[^1]。这个函数返回字典中键值对的数量。例如:
```python
dict = {'Name': 'Zara', 'Age': 7}
print("字典长度 : %d" % len(dict)) # 输出:2
```
另外,如果你想要创建一个新的空字典并立即获取其长度,可以使用`fromkeys()`函数来创建一个具有指定序列元素的新字典,但请注意这并不会改变字典的长度,因为默认情况下它会创建一个与输入序列相同长度的空字典:
```python
seq = ['a', 'b', 'c']
dict = dict.fromkeys(seq)
print("新的字典为 : %s" % str(dict)) # 输出:{'a': None, 'b': None, 'c': None}
print("字典长度 : %d" % len(dict)) -- 相关问题--
1. 如何判断字典是否为空?
2. `fromkeys()`函数还可以接受什么类型的参数?
3. 使用`len()`函数时,如果字典中有None作为键值,长度会怎么计算?
阅读全文